ISLAMABAD, March 12 Asia Pulse - National Telecom Corporation (NTC) Saturday announced a reduction in its broadband tariff for DSL services in order to facilitate its subscribers as well as help aggressive implementation of government policies on e-enable and IT development.
Officials said that enhanced quality of service, fast downloading, NTC has increased its international Bandwidth more than four times (from 78 Mbps to 310 Mbps). They said the aim in enhancing the service and reducing charges was to extend Internet access to every nook and corner of the country for the changing environment and paving the way to establish knowledge-based economy and enhance e-awareness of the society.
They said new reduced tariffs of broadband for government functionaries have been made as low as Rs 650 (around US$10), which could play vital role in speedy penetration of broadband services. They said NTC has activated Internet for all of its designated subscribers through dial-up access (Access Telephone No. 93199998, login-ntc, password ntc).
They said all government serving/retired officers and officials having NTC Telephone number (with 92 and 93 prefix) can avail these facilities only detailed information is available at NTC website www.ntc.net.pk.
